Travelling from Nuremberg Airport (NUE) to Faro Airport (FAO): what you need to know
The average length of a direct flight from Nuremberg Airport to Faro Airport is 3 hours 15 minutes.
Faro's timezone is UTC+0, making Faro one hour behind Nuremberg.
To ensure you catch your NUE to FAO flight, allow plenty of time for things like baggage drop and finding your gate. Arriving two hours ahead of international departures and an hour before domestic flights is the general rule.
Flying during a peak time like September? Public holidays and other popular seasons can result in longer queues and delays at security. Play it safe and arrive up to four hours before an international flight and two hours before domestic departures.

Handy information about Nuremberg Airport (NUE)
75% of flights taking off from Nuremberg Airport reach their destination on time.
Nuremberg Airport is about 8 kilometres from central Nuremberg. If you're driving, catching a taxi or ride-sharing from the centre, it'll take you 20 minutes or so to get there, depending on the traffic.
The journey on public transport takes about 10 minutes.

When to fly to Faro Airport (FAO)
August is the busiest month for flights from Nuremberg Airport to Faro Airport. For a quieter experience, go to Faro in February.
Lock in your flight from Nuremberg Airport to Faro Airport for August if you want to visit Faro during its warmest month. You can expect temperatures of between 19ºC (66ºF) and 29ºC (84ºF).
Look for cheap tickets from NUE to FAO in January if you want to travel in cooler conditions. Temperatures are at their lowest around then, ranging between 9ºC (48ºF) and 16ºC (61ºF) on average.
